What a licensed -responder in fact does in the first 10 minutes
A licensed -responder is not a paramedic. They are a coworker, trained to do the few activities that purchase time and oxygen. The initial job is scene security, scanning for dangers prior to kneeling down. The second is a quick assessment: less competent, not taking a breath generally, no pulse really felt by an ordinary rescuer. Then the cascade begins: call for assistance, begin breast compressions, affix an AED if readily available, provide a shock if recommended, proceed compressions, keep the airway clear, and turn over to paramedics with a succinct recap. Succeeded, these steps are easy, deliberate, and repeatable under stress.
The top quality of those compressions matters more than many people think. Deepness around 5 to 6 centimetres for adults, a rate near 100 to 120 per minute, full recoil. That rhythm maintains a trickle of perfusion that keeps stability alive. The AED includes the 2nd column, very early defibrillation. For shockable rhythms like ventricular fibrillation, every squandered minute without a shock goes down survival chances by 7 to 10 percent. The -responder's capability to turn on the AED, comply with the triggers without 2nd thinking, get rid of the client before providing the shock, and return on the chest swiftly, that precision pulls an individual back from the brink.

AED placement and the rate problem
CPR without defibrillation will certainly keep somebody going, yet it seldom brings back a shockable rhythm by itself. An automated exterior defibrillator closes that gap. The placement of AEDs is both a human factors issue and a logistical one. Accessibility defeats visual appeals. Put the AED where people can reach it in under 90 secs from most likely occurrence places, not locked in a back workplace. Clear signage at eye degree, noticeable from several angles, and a cabinet alarm system that draws attention when opened up, not to discourage use but to mobilize helpers.
In multi-level websites, aim for one AED per flooring or per 2000 square meters, adjusted by foot traffic patterns. In high-risk locations like health clubs and workshops, closer is better. If your building shares an AED with neighboring lessees, settle on upkeep responsibilities and ensure everybody knows the closet code if locked. Battery and pad expiration days creep up. Assign a called person to regular monthly checks and maintain a log. A dead AED is incorrect confidence.

The edge situations that journey individuals up
Real incidents seldom match the book. An individual might be wheezing in agonal breaths that sound "practically normal" to the inexperienced ear. That delay sets you back mins. Instruct personnel the distinction. An additional usual grab is the assumption that electrical burns or water direct exposure make AED use hazardous. Modern AEDs are risk-free when the breast is wiped completely dry and nobody is touching the person at shock. Fashion jewelry, underwire bras, piercings, and pacemakers raise questions. Pads walk around, out, a pacemaker lump, and precious jewelry is not a contraindication if you place pads correctly.
In limited rooms like restroom stalls or crowded storage rooms, -responders think twice to relocate a client. You may need to drag by the shoulders or clothes to an open area for compressions. For overweight individuals, deepness and recoil need deliberate force and strategy. Rotating compressors every 2 minutes prevents tiredness. If a person has a tracheostomy, air flow changes, but compressions remain the same. If trauma is believed, focus on hemorrhaging control and airway monitoring while still getting ready for CPR if breathing and pulse are absent. These information sound technological. They are learnable with practice and great instruction.
